In between the two "Godfather" movies, Al Pacino starred in “Serpico,” where he plays an exemplary New York City cop who exposes corruption in the NYPD and paid the ultimate price for his integrity. It was a project that had been kicked around Hollywood for a few years but was shelved for a while because of the huge success of that other mobster movie, “Goodfellas.” When the film was finally released in 1997, Al Pacino was the only A-lister that was still attached to the project—and he remained the film’s melancholy heart and tortured soul. In 1985, Al Pacino – one of the most famous screen actors in the world – starred in Revolution, a historical drama set at the time of the American Revolution.It was a big budget film, boasted a talented award winning director Hugh Hudson and it flopped harder than Oliver Hardy from a high diving board. Then in 1992 came the famous volley of hoo-ahs from retired Army Lt. Col. Frank Slade, the blind, alcoholic, tango-dancing officer portrayed by Al Pacino in “Scent of a Woman.” 24 Apr 2020 10:23 AM. "Hooah" also features prominently in Black Hawk Down, which depicts United States Army Rangers at the 1993 Battle of Mogadishu, Somalia and Lions for Lambs a film about the war in Afghanistan.
